How do you separate instruments in audacity?
To split a stereo track, click on the downward pointing arrow at the top of the Track Control Panel then click on Split Stereo to Mono. To delete the unwanted channel, click the [X] to left of the downward pointing arrow. If you accidentally delete the wrong channel, use Edit > Undo to get it back.
How do you delete in Audacity without moving?
The command you are looking for is Split Delete (Ctrl+Alt+K). This will split the audio at the beginning and end of your selection and delete the middle.

Is there a way to split recording into multiple tracks?
This is easily accomplished in Audacity, using labels and the export multiple function. Using labels to split your recording into multiple tracks requires you to record all your tracks into one audio track on the Audacity screen.
